I Run Off of windows me now, i used to use 98 and my file extensions would show up, (ex, Crash_Course_Canyon.map, SummerVacation.jpg,Short_Stuff's.Html)
Any time i wanted i could change a music file from mp3 to wav but now i have this and the extensions dont't show and when ever i try to change anything to html, or wav or text it dont work...can anyone help me?

Waris 27 Mar 2006
Go to My Computer, click Tools, select Folder Options, click on the View tab, at the Advanced setting rollout, choose it and uncheck the 'Hide extension for known file types' box.
CodeCat 27 Mar 2006
But remember that renaming a file won't change its internal format. Just cause it's called .wav doesnt mean it really IS a wav file.
Short Stuff 27 Mar 2006
I need to do that for my site music because it only accepts .wav formating not mp3 on my old computer i could do it but not on this one
CodeCat 27 Mar 2006
Well then this isn't going to help. You need a sound editing program to open the mp3 file and then save it in wav format.
